Research the Brand and Product Details

Before making a purchase or listing an item, familiarize yourself with the specific brand's characteristics. Each designer brand has unique features that distinguish authentic pieces from fakes. Here are some useful tips:

  • Study Official Resources: Visit the brand’s official website or authorized retailers to understand their logos, stitching, hardware, and packaging.
  • Examine Authenticity Features: Look for authenticity cards, serial numbers, holograms, or branded hardware that are typical for the brand.
  • Review Product Listings: Search for similar items online and compare details such as measurements, materials, and design features.

For example, a Louis Vuitton bag typically features a specific monogram pattern, date code, and high-quality craftsmanship. Knowing these details helps you identify genuine items.


Inspect Physical Features and Craftsmanship

One of the most effective ways to authenticate a luxury item is to carefully examine its physical features:

  • Materials: Genuine designer items use premium materials. Feel the texture, weight, and quality of leather, fabric, and hardware.
  • Stitching: Authentic pieces often have even, tight, and consistent stitching. Loose threads or uneven seams can be signs of fakes.
  • Hardware and Logo Placement: Check the hardware for engravings, logos, and quality. Hardware on real designer items is usually heavy and engraved with brand names.
  • Serial Numbers and Tags: Many brands include serial numbers, authenticity tags, or holograms. Verify these details carefully against official records.

For example, a genuine Chanel flap bag will have a serial number sticker inside that matches the authenticity card, with serials that can be verified through Chanel’s customer service or authentication experts.


Utilize Authentication Services and Experts

When in doubt, turn to professional authentication services. Several reputable companies specialize in verifying luxury items:

  • Third-Party Authentication Services: Companies like Authenticate First, Real Authentication, or Entrupy offer expert opinions for a fee.
  • Luxury Authentication Apps: Apps like Entrupy or AuthenticatePro use AI and expert analysis to verify authenticity.
  • Consultation with Experts: Reach out to luxury consignment stores or specialists who can provide insights based on photos or in-person inspection.

For instance, if you're unsure about a Gucci bag, submitting detailed photos to a trusted authentication service can provide peace of mind before completing the transaction.


Communicate with the Seller

Engaging with the seller can provide additional assurance. When buying on Poshmark:

  • Ask for Detailed Photos: Request close-ups of logos, tags, serial numbers, hardware, and stitching.
  • Request Original Receipts or Authenticity Cards: Authentic items often come with official documentation.
  • Inquire About the Item’s History: Ask where and when the item was purchased, and if there’s any proof of authenticity.

Clear communication and detailed photos can help verify authenticity and build trust with the seller.


Check Seller Reviews and Ratings

Poshmark allows buyers to review and rate sellers. Always review a seller’s ratings and comments:

  • Positive Feedback: High ratings and positive comments about authenticity suggest credibility.
  • Repeat Customers: Sellers with many satisfied buyers are often more reliable.
  • Red Flags: Negative reviews or complaints about counterfeit items should raise concern.

Prioritize purchasing from established, reputable sellers who have a track record of authentic sales.


Understand Poshmark’s Authentication Policies

Poshmark has implemented authentication programs for certain high-end or designer categories:

  • Posh Authenticate: A program where luxury items over a certain value are reviewed by professional authenticators before sale completion.
  • Seller Requirements: Some sellers specializing in luxury items undergo verification to ensure authenticity.

Familiarize yourself with these policies to know when you can rely on Poshmark’s authentication services and when additional verification might be necessary.
